Orange County Fire Authority crews used a boat to rescue a man and woman who were clinging to the side of a flood control channel beneath a bridge in Santa Ana.

California firefighters saved two people who were caught in a flood control channel Monday.

Orange County Fire Authority crews performed the rescue just before 5 p.m. in Santa Ana, according to the department. A man and woman were clinging to the side of a flood control channel beneath a bridge, Capt. Thanh Nguyen told the Orange County Register.

Firefighters deployed a boat under the bridge to rescue the two people, and medics evaluated them at the scene. The woman was taken to the hospital for knee pains, but the man didn't need treatment, Nguyen told the Register.
